It seems like Royal Enfield is all set to launch their all-new revised Bullet 500 in sometime soon. This is confirmed by the latest teaser images that appear in their site.
If the Bullet 500 is launched again, the cast Iron Engine lovers can very well book their bikes after almost a decade. The introduction of AVL engine that churned out 24ps made way for the 22ps UCE engine out from the production line.
The latest of the 500cc engine that came out from the Royal Enfield factory had top of the line features like Electronic Fuel Injection, Disc Brakes, Twin Spark Ignition that churned out 27.5ps of raw power and what not; in a few attractive shades too. As the images portray the new Bullet 500 will be available in a dark shade of Green that takes us back to the Vintage models that came with the same color as seen in the teaser pictures. From the Images it is clearly seen that the bike is a carb version of the 500cc mill and the power and torque factors are expected to be closely in sync with the EFI Classic 500.
